Smoltz: Mets 'Way better' than '90s Braves starters

Here’s something interesting: In an interview with the Daily News, Hall of Famer John Smoltz said the Mets’ group of young starting pitchers is “way better” than the 1990s Braves rotation that featured Smoltz and fellow Hall of Famers Tom Glavine and Greg Maddux:

They’re way better,” Smoltz said of the Mets in comparison to his Braves rotation, which featured five elite pitchers all under the age of 30, including Hall of Famers Greg Maddux and Tom Glavine. “They’ve got more talent than we could ever have.”…

“The opportunities that exist today won’t allow a lot of staffs to find out what kind of staff they can be.
